Minutes — Management Meeting

Prepared for the incoming director. Topic: possible acquisition of Greyfen Analytics. Due diligence 70% complete. Valuation gap remains; Greyfen seeks a premium. Integration risks flagged by Ops. Decision deferred to next month. Talla Nyberg leads negotiations. Our walk-away position is stated below.

board note of fawig-kagup: Only 48 of the 435 pilot accounts renewed Rusion, so a churn review is set for September 12. Fenwynox Logistics is in early talks to buy Sorielek Systems for about $117.8 million.

# Break-Glass: Catalog Cache Invalidation

Scope: the Pinrow product catalog at Veldstone Retail. If stale prices persist after a purge and the Hollowmere invalidation queue is wedged, use break-glass to flush the edge tier directly. Contractors: get verbal sign-off from the catalog lead first. Steps: open the Hollowmere admin shell, select emergency-flush, confirm the tenant, and run it once — repeated flushes thrash the origin. Access is logged and expires after 20 minutes. Unseal the admin shell with the passphrase below.

recovery phrase for kahop-tajog: istix-casvan

## Configuration

Heads up for the sync: `shrinkray`, our batch image resizer CLI, finally has sane config. No more flags the length of your arm — everything lives in `.shrinkray.env` now. Set `SR_OUTPUT_DIR` for where resized images land, `SR_MAX_WORKERS` (default 4, bump it on the big Falkmere boxes), and `SR_FORMAT=webp` if you want the new encoder. Uploads to the Plimworth asset store are on by default, and that needs an API secret in the env file, right here:

secret setting of yajog-taguf: ARCHIVE_KEY3=051

## Action Item: Invoice Renderer Timeouts (Follow-up from INC-Paperbark)

During the outage, the Paperbark PDF renderer held worker threads while waiting on font fetches, starving the queue. We agreed to add hard render timeouts and a bounded retry budget, plus a smaller in-process font cache so cold starts don't cascade. Mireille will own rollout to the Oslund staging tier this sprint; production follows after one clean week. The new timeout and cache constants we settled on are listed below.

tuning table, yajog-yahof:
BUDGETS = {
    "lamvan": 303,
    "wenox": 460,
    "fenvan": 525,
}